Understanding the Unique Anatomy of Ferret Digestive Systems
Ferrets possess a distinctive digestive anatomy that is adapted to their carnivorous diet. Their gastrointestinal tract is relatively short compared to other mammals, which reflects their evolutionary adaptation to a diet high in protein and low in carbohydrates. This short digestive system allows for rapid digestion and nutrient absorption, crucial for their high energy levels and activity.
The stomach of a ferret is highly acidic, with a pH level that aids in breaking down proteins effectively. Following the stomach, the small intestine is the primary site for nutrient absorption, where enzymes continue to break down food into usable forms. The large intestine is shorter and plays a minimal role in fermentation, as ferrets are not designed to extract nutrients from fibrous plant material.
Moreover, the unique structure of the ferret’s cecum, which is small in comparison to that of herbivores, limits the breakdown of cellulose. This anatomical feature further reinforces the need for a meat-based diet, as ferrets lack the necessary digestive enzymes to process plant materials effectively. Understanding this anatomy is vital for providing appropriate dietary choices that align with their digestive capabilities.
The Role of Enzymes in Ferret Food Digestion
Enzymes are biochemical catalysts that play a significant role in the digestion of food, facilitating the breakdown of complex molecules into simpler forms that the body can absorb. In ferrets, several key enzymes are produced in the pancreas and the small intestine to aid in the digestion of proteins, fats, and carbohydrates. The primary enzymes involved include proteases for protein digestion, lipases for fat digestion, and amylases for carbohydrate breakdown.
Proteases are particularly critical for ferrets, as their diet is predominantly protein-based. These enzymes help break down proteins into amino acids, which are essential for various bodily functions, including muscle repair and hormone production. The effective action of these enzymes ensures that ferrets can efficiently utilize the high protein content in their food, supporting their active lifestyle.
Furthermore, the role of enzymes extends beyond mere digestion; they are crucial for maintaining overall health. A deficiency in specific digestive enzymes can lead to malabsorption of nutrients, ultimately affecting a ferret’s energy levels and immune function. Therefore, understanding the role of enzymes in a ferret’s digestive process is crucial for ensuring they receive a balanced diet that meets their nutritional needs.
Dietary Needs: What Ferrets Should and Should Not Eat
Ferrets are obligate carnivores, meaning their diet should primarily consist of animal-based proteins. High-quality commercial ferret food is typically formulated to meet these dietary needs, containing the necessary proteins and fats to support their health. Ideal diets are rich in animal protein, with a focus on whole meats and animal by-products, as these are naturally aligned with their nutritional requirements.
In addition to protein, ferrets require a moderate amount of fat in their diet, which serves as a vital energy source. However, it is crucial to avoid excessive fat content, as this can lead to obesity and related health issues. Ferrets should also not be fed fruits, vegetables, or grains, as their digestive systems are not adapted to process these foods. Such items can lead to gastrointestinal distress and should be strictly avoided.
When caring for a ferret, it is essential to provide a balanced diet while being aware of harmful foods. Items such as chocolate, onions, and garlic are toxic to ferrets and can cause severe health issues. Educating oneself about what constitutes a proper ferret diet is crucial for ensuring the well-being of these energetic pets and preventing dietary-related health problems.
Common Digestive Issues in Ferrets and Solutions
Despite their robust digestive systems, ferrets can experience various digestive issues, which can arise from dietary indiscretions, stress, or underlying health conditions. One common problem is diarrhea, which can be caused by sudden dietary changes or the introduction of inappropriate foods. This condition can lead to dehydration and nutrient loss, making prompt intervention necessary.
Another frequent digestive issue in ferrets is gastrointestinal blockage, often resulting from ingesting foreign objects or hairballs. Symptoms may include vomiting, lethargy, and a lack of appetite. In cases of suspected blockage, immediate veterinary care is essential to prevent more severe complications. Regular grooming and monitoring of a ferret’s environment can help reduce the risk of ingesting non-food items.
Finally, ferrets are also susceptible to inflammatory bowel disease (IBD), which can lead to chronic diarrhea and weight loss. This condition requires thorough veterinary assessment and may necessitate dietary adjustments, medication, or both. Maintaining good communication with a veterinarian regarding a ferret’s digestive health can help in identifying problems early and ensuring appropriate treatment.
